Block

#21,885,374
Block Number
21,885,374 @ 06/08/2025, 11:43:10
Status
Finalized
ID
0x014df1be014d805f77a67b61ff664f29ce1ff9281e9a56a289df50fbfffdac09
Transactions
Gas Used
7409831/40000000 (18.52% Used)
Total Score
2,137,443,622 (+97)
Rewards
29.22 VTHO